Output 133afa28b034362bb59986d7fd1e3c4e0cfc6d6d4d2f90231bd32ec3243496b5:0

value
66801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d746d4bdf1d2c13e6cc6cd0eb21942e8109bb1a OP_EQUAL
address
38kZRoNEjyDPGn5EaNUAkJRR1PQKApRg7H
transaction
133afa28b034362bb59986d7fd1e3c4e0cfc6d6d4d2f90231bd32ec3243496b5
spent
true